Teriyaki Chicken

Prep Time: 15 Minutes | Cook Time 30 Minutes | Serves: 4 | See Full Video Below

Ingredients:

  • 4 Boneless and Skinless Chicken Thighs
  • 1/2 Cup Soy Sauce
  • 1/4 Cup Water
  • 1/4 Cup Brown Sugar
  • 2 Tbsp Mirin
  • 1 Tbsp Ginger
  • 2 Cloves Garlic
  • 1 Head of Broccoli
  • 1 Cup Rice
  • 1 Tbsp Corn Starch 
  • 1 tsp Toasted Sesame Seeds
  • 1/4 tsp Red Pepper Flakes
  • 1 Tbsp Green Onion
  • Salt and Pepper to taste

Directions:

  • Mix soy sauce, water, brown sugar, mirin, ginger (grated) and garlic (minced) in a bowl to make the teriyaki sauce, then set aside
  • Season the chicken with salt and pepper, then sear in a pan over medium-high heat for 5 to 6 minutes per side or until golden brown, then remove 
  • Chop off the stem of the broccoli and cut the broccoli into florets by chopping into bite-sized pieces 
  • Steam the broccoli for 15 minutes and while that’s steaming cook 1 cup of rice
  • After the broccoli is done, pour the teriyaki sauce into the same pan and simmer for about 2 to 3 minutes 
  • Add the cornstarch to a small bowl with twice the amount of water (1-2 ratio of cornstarch to cold water) to make a cornstarch slurry
  • Stir the cornstarch slurry into the sauce until it thickens a bit, then add the chicken back in with the red pepper flakes and toasted sesame seeds
  • Plate with rice first then broccoli, then, cover the rice with chicken and pour the teriyaki sauce over everything
  • Garnish with chopped green onions and enjoy!
